Windows下配置MySQL(5.7.21)数据库

大好的周末,本该是打机、出游、睡觉的好时机。撸主,却在这里写博客… … 吊丝,注孤老。不管怎么样,希望,这篇文章,能帮到你。

一、下载MySQL。
我下的是mysql-5.7.21-winx64。这是MySQL的下载地址:https://dev.mysql.com/downloads/mysql/ 。在里面找到对应你的系统和位数的版本下载即可。

二、解压MySQL。
找一个位置,最好是磁盘的根目录,或者其它路径,但老套路,别带中文路径,总是可以省去一些BUG。我是直接放在E盘的根目录。地址如下:E:\mysql-5.7.21-winx64

三、配置系统环境变量。
这一步,主要是将MySQL的cmd命令加入到系统环境变量Path里面去。这样,你就可以在cmd中的,任意路径下,执行MySQL的相关命令。这一步非必需,却很必要。强烈建议照做,下面的例子都基于一这步而做的,不照做,下面的步骤可能执行不了。 添加步骤,如下图解 :

**1、**右键“我的电脑”或“计算机”,然后,再点击“属性”。
这里写图片描述

2、 点击 高级系统设置。

这里写图片描述

3、 点击 环境变量。
这里写图片描述

4、 在下面,系统变量一栏。找到,Path变量。(注意,右边的滚动条,是可以上下滚动查找的… 虽然这话有点多余,但还是补上,避免一些… 好了,继续往下看)。 在找到Path变量后,双击它,或是点击下面的编辑按钮。所有的相关信息,我都在图片中用红色的圈圈标出来了。

这里写图片描述

5、添加环境变量。 把MySQL的安装路径下的bin目录的路径作为地址,添加在变量值一栏的最后面。
比如,我的MySQL的安装路径是:E:\mysql-5.7.21-winx64。那么,我要添加到环境变量中的地址,就是:E:\mysql-5.7.21-winx64\bin;。。。 另外,还有个要点,重要的事要说三遍,这很重要,请注意,请注意,请注意:如果你要添加的位置,前面没有 ; 分号。你就需要,添加个 ; 分号在路径前面。。。所以,完整的是这样的“ ; E:\mysql-5.7.21-winx64\bin” , 然后,为了以后,添加其它变量方便,在这个地址后面,也请添加一个 ; 分号,做分隔符。 具体的细节,可以看一下,图片所示。。。如果后面,发现,mysql的相关命令找不到,可以再来仔细看一下这一步。最后,点击确定按钮,保存起来就行了。
这里写图片描述

四、在MySQL的解压路径下,添加my.ini文件(比如,我的就是添加在这个文件夹里面,E:\mysql-5.7.21-winx64)。该文件是一个描述MySQL配置信息的文件,在安装MySQL时会用到里面的配置信息。… 请务必注意,文件的命名、后缀,都要严格遵守。我一开始,把my改成setting,变成setting.ini。结果,就导致了配置失败。请注意!!!另外,我给的配置信息里面,有两个要你自己改,一个是basedir=xxxx,一个是datadir=xxx\data。你只要把xxx,改成你自己的MySQL的解压路径即可。

里面,#号开头的,代表注释。skip-grant-tables 这一行是用来跳过登录密码验证的,因为安装后的初始密码不知道是啥,先用这一步跳过。等进去数库后,改了登录密码后,再将这一行注释掉就行,像这样# skip-grant-tables
修改登录密码的,可以参考这篇:MySQL学习之修改登录密码

[mysql]  
# 设置mysql客户端默认字符集  
default-character-set=utf8  
[mysqld]  
#跳过登录密码验证
skip-grant-tables
#设置3306端口  
port = 3306  
# 设置mysql的安装目录  
basedir=E:\mysql-5.7.21-winx64
# 设置mysql数据库的数据的存放目录  
datadir=E:\mysql-5.7.21-winx64\data  
# 允许最大连接数  
max_connections=200  
# 服务端使用的字符集默认为8比特编码的latin1字符集  
character-set-server=utf8  
# 创建新表时将使用的默认存储引擎  
default-storage-engine=INNODB

**五、添加完my.ini后,打开CMD。然后,依次,执行下面的指令。这样,MySQL就成功的安装,并启动了。有图有真相!另外,关闭服务器的命名是:net stop mysql。其它的命令,自行百度查找。 **

命令:mysqld --initialize   #直接初始化mysql,生成data文件夹中的文件。

命令:mysqld -install          #安装mysql

命令:net start mysql          #启动服务器

这里写图片描述

六,修改登录密码(非必需),这是另一篇文章 的内容:MySQL学习之修改登录密码


到此为止,我们已经安装并配置好MySQL数据库了。Thank you for reading my posted. If you have any questions, You can comment below. Thank you.

  • 4
    点赞
  • 15
    收藏
    觉得还不错? 一键收藏
  • 2
    评论
### 回答1: MySQL 5.7.21是一个常用的关系型数据库管理系统,以下是它的安装配置教程: 1. 下载MySQL安装包:在MySQL官方网站上下载MySQL 5.7.21的安装包,选择与你的操作系统版本相对应的安装包。 2. 安装MySQL:双击安装包,根据安装向导的提示进行安装。在安装向导中选择“完整”安装类型,以便安装所有的MySQL组件。 3. 配置MySQL:安装完成后,打开MySQL的安装目录,在目录中找到my.ini文件(Windows操作系统)或my.cnf文件(Linux/Unix操作系统),用文本编辑器打开。 4. 配置MySQL的字符集:在配置文件中找到[mysqld]节,添加或修改字符集的配置,例如: character-set-server=utf8 collation-server=utf8_general_ci 5. 配置MySQL的端口号:在配置文件中找到[mysqld]节,添加或修改端口号的配置,例如: port=3306 6. 配置MySQL的日志文件:在配置文件中找到[mysqld]节,添加或修改日志文件的配置,例如: log-error=mysql_error.log 7. 启动MySQL服务:根据你的操作系统,通过命令行或服务管理器启动MySQL服务。 8. 设置MySQL的root用户密码:通过命令行登录MySQL,输入以下命令修改root用户的密码: mysql -u root -p ALTER USER 'root'@'localhost' IDENTIFIED BY 'your_new_password'; 9. 配置MySQL的防火墙规则:如果你的操作系统有防火墙,需要添加允许MySQL访问的规则。 10. 测试MySQL连接:打开命令行,输入以下命令测试与MySQL的连接: mysql -u root -p 输入密码后成功连接表示安装配置成功。 以上就是MySQL 5.7.21的安装配置教程,希望对你有所帮助。 ### 回答2: MySQL是一种开源的关系型数据库管理系统,被广泛应用于Web开发中。下面是MySQL 5.7.21版本的安装配置教程: 1.在MySQL官网(https://dev.mysql.com/downloads/mysql/)下载适用于你的操作系统的安装包。根据操作系统选择合适的版本,比如Windows 64位版本。 2.双击安装包进行安装,按照提示进行操作。可以选择自定义安装路径和组件。 3.选择是否安装MySQL Server和MySQL Workbench等组件,根据需要进行选择并确认安装。 4.在安装程序中选择自定义配置方式,可以设置MySQL服务的端口号、字符集、权限验证方式等。 5.设置root用户的密码。强烈建议设置一个强密码来保护数据库的安全性。 6.选择启用MySQL服务作为Windows系统的服务,以便系统启动时自动启动MySQL服务。 7.完成安装后,可以使用MySQL Workbench等工具连接到MySQL服务器。在工具中输入MySQL服务器的IP地址、端口号、用户名和密码进行连接。 8.连接成功后,可以创建新的数据库、新的表以及对数据进行增删改查等操作。 9.在配置文件my.cnf中可以对MySQL进行进一步配置,如设置缓冲区大小、最大连接数、超时时间等。 10.在使用MySQL过程中,要注意保持数据库的备份和定期维护工作,以确保数据的安全性和稳定性。 以上是MySQL 5.7.21版本的安装配置教程,希望对你有帮助。若有任何疑问,可以参考官方文档或在相关社区寻求帮助。 ### 回答3: MySQL是一种常用的开源关系型数据库管理系统,本文将为您详细介绍MySQL 5.7.21的安装配置教程。 首先,您需要从MySQL官方网站下载MySQL 5.7.21的安装包,并解压到您选择的安装目录。接下来,打开命令行界面,进入MySQL的安装目录,执行以下命令以进行初始配置: 1. 执行命令`mysqld --initialize --console`来初始化MySQL的数据目录。这将生成一个临时密码,要牢记这个密码,因为您稍后需要用到它。 2. 执行命令`mysqld --install`来安装MySQL服务。 3. 执行命令`net start mysql`来启动MySQL服务。如果您希望MySQL服务在每次开机时自动启动,可以执行命令`sc config mysql start=auto`来设置自动启动。 4. 执行命令`mysql_secure_installation`来进行数据库的初始设置。按照提示依次输入临时密码以及设置新密码、删除匿名用户、禁止root远程登录、删除测试数据库等操作。 至此,MySQL 5.7.21的安装和基本配置已经完成。 接下来,您可以使用图形界面工具(如Navicat、MySQL Workbench等)或命令行工具(如MySQL Shell、MySQL命令行客户端等)连接到MySQL服务器,并进行数据库操作。 需要注意的是,MySQL配置文件(my.ini或my.cnf)位于MySQL的安装目录下,您可以根据需要对其进行修改来调整MySQL配置。 总结:通过下载MySQL 5.7.21的安装包,解压、配置、安装、初始化及设置等步骤,完成了MySQL 5.7.21的安装和基本配置。接下来,您可以使用适当的工具连接到MySQL服务器,并进行数据库操作。 希望以上对您有所帮助!
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值